2017-06-23 70 views
1

我正在嘗試將bot分析(https://github.com/Botanalytics/botanalytics-microsoftbotframework-middleware)集成到azure bot服務中。將npm包安裝到Azure Bot Service中

但是,由於我對node.js非常陌生,我不知道如何使用npm在azure中安裝軟件包。我所做的是將「npm install botanalytics-microsoftbotframework-middleware」輸入到azure雲殼中。

但是,當我檢查node_modules和package.json(截圖下方)文件夾時,它沒有顯示在那裏。

這應該是一個相當noob問題,但我在我的知識僅限於解決自己...

謝謝!

enter image description here

[編輯]

{ 
    "name": "luisbot", 
    "version": "1.0.0", 
    "description": "", 
    "main": "index.js", 
    "dependencies": { 
    "botbuilder": "^3.7.0", 
    "botbuilder-azure": "3.0.2", 
    "botanalytics-microsoftbotframework-middleware": "0.0.1" 
    }, 
    "devDependencies": { 
     "restify": "^4.3.0" 
    }, 
    "scripts": { 
    "test": "echo \"Error: no test specified\" && exit 1" 
    }, 
    "author": "", 
    "license": "ISC" 
} 

回答

1

添加NPM模塊名稱和版本到你的package.json依賴關係部分,並保存文件。 Bot服務將檢測到更改併爲您運行npm install。

+0

嗨,它似乎沒有工作。我將它添加到package.json> dependencies中,但似乎在luis包下?它沒有安裝我需要的軟件包。你怎麼看?謝謝 – Jake